Synopsis:

Spoiler:
"Ka Hakaka Maika'i"* - The FIVE-0's investigation into the murder of a wealthy restaurant owner causes McGarrett to take part in a charity MMA fight to the finish. Meanwhile, NCIS Agent Kensi Blye lends her expertise to McGarrett and Lt. Commander White when they ask her to examine a video of McGarrett's father, on HAWAII FIVE-0, Monday, Oct. 24 (10:00-11:00 PM, ET/PT) on the CBS Television Network. Daniela Ruah (NCIS: Los Angeles) guest stars as Agent Kensi Blye. Former MMA champion Chuck Liddell guest stars as himself.

Loved finally seeing Mark Dacascos use his martial arts skills finally. Joe White actually held his own against Wo Fat.

The opening segment with McGarrett at the MMA fight against Chuck Liddell turned out to be just a lame throw away segment for the end. I do have to give Alex O'Loughlin credit, he's in excellent physical condition.

Some good guest stars in this episode. Shawn Hatosy from Southland, Annie Wersching from 24 and of course O'Quinn and Dacascos.

Okay....Now here's my complaint. Why the hell did they fly in Daniela Ruah from NCIS Los Angeles to act in a 2 minute segment to read lips in that security video? They could have easily sent that video to LA. I like Kensi Blye and that was a serious waste of her talent for that. So it appears that NCIS and H50 are in the same universe. Don't be surprised to see another crossover in the near future.
